Piers Morgan honestly reacted to the performance of the Gunners’ chief playmaker during the clash with AFC Bournemouth at the Emirates stadium on Wednesday night.

Arsenal manager Unai Emery once again decided to rotate much of his team after watching them comfortably dispatch Southampton at home on Sunday afternoon.

Emery’s changes saw some of the players who featured in the win over BATE Borisov return to the starting eleven as the Gunners looked to keep their place in the top four of the Premier League.

One of the players who was back in the side was Mesut Ozil, a man often left out of the squad this season.

The former Real Madrid star made a huge difference in the game in the first half alone as he opened the scoring with a lovely chipped effort before setting up Arsenal’s second goal.

That saw Piers Morgan honestly admit that Ozil is indeed a frustrating player who is hot today and then cold tomorrow.

The midfielder has occasionally produced moments of brilliance like he did on Wednesday but he has also been criticised on several occasions for failing to make an impact in games.
